Ingredients

Gather the following ingredients for a delicious Mushroom Frittata:

Ingredients

  • 6 large eggs
  • 1 cup sliced mushrooms
  • 1 cup chopped kale
  • 1/2 cup grated Asiago cheese
  • 1/4 cup milk
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Make sure to have all these ingredients ready before you start cooking!

Instructions

Follow these simple steps to create your Mushroom Frittata:

Prepare the Ingredients

In a b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, salt, and pepper. Set aside.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at, then add garlic and mushrooms. Sauté until mushrooms are tender.

Cook the Kale

Add the chopped kale to the skillet and cook for another 2-3 minutes until wilted.

Combine and Cook

Pour the egg mixture over the vegetables in the skillet. Sprinkle Asiago cheese on top.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ook for about 15-20 minutes, or until eggs are set.

Serve

Once cooked, slice the frittata and serve warm. Enjoy your delicious Mushroom Frittata!

Storing and Reheating

To store your Mushroom Frittata, allow it to cool completely before covering it with plastic wrap or transferring it to an airtight container. It can be kept in the refrigerator for up to a week, making it a perfect make-ahead option for busy mornings.

When it’s time to enjoy your frittata again, simply reheat it in the microwave for 30-60 seconds or warm it in a skillet over low heat until heated through. This dish retains its flavor and texture beautifully, ensuring you can savor every bite just as much as the first time.

Questions About Recipes

→ Can I use other types of cheese?

Yes, you can substitute Asiago with cheddar, feta, or any cheese of your choice.

→ Is this frittata gluten-free?

Yes, this Mushroom Frittata is gluten-free as it doesn't contain any flour or gluten-containing ingredients.

→ Can I make this frittata 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the frittata in advance and reheat it when ready to serve.

→ What can I serve with the frittata?

This frittata pairs well with a fresh salad, crusty bread, or roasted vegetables.

Nutritional Breakdown (Per Serving)

  • Calories: 300 kcal
  • Total Fat: 20g
  • Saturated Fat: 7g
  • Cholesterol: 400mg
  • Sodium: 300mg
  • Total Carbohydrates: 6g
  • Dietary Fiber: 1g
  • Sugars: 2g
  • Protein: 24g
